在Excel中重复最后一行数据库的方法有多种,包括直接复制粘贴、使用VBA代码、利用公式以及其他高级技巧。其中,直接复制粘贴是最简单的方法,而使用VBA代码和公式则更加灵活和自动化。为了详细描述这些方法,我们将从几个方面进行深入探讨。
一、直接复制粘贴
1、基础操作
直接复制粘贴是最简单的方式,只需选中最后一行,复制内容,然后粘贴到目标位置。具体步骤如下:
- 选中最后一行的所有单元格。
- 按下快捷键Ctrl+C复制内容。
- 选中目标位置的第一行。
- 按下快捷键Ctrl+V粘贴内容。
这种方法适用于小型数据库或临时操作,效率较低,但非常直观。
2、快捷键技巧
在Excel中使用快捷键可以提高效率。以下是一些常用的快捷键:
- Ctrl+C:复制选中的内容。
- Ctrl+V:粘贴复制的内容。
- Ctrl+Shift+Arrow:快速选择连续的数据区域。
利用这些快捷键可以更快速地完成复制粘贴操作。
二、使用VBA代码
1、简介
VBA(Visual Basic for Applications)是一种用于编写Excel宏的编程语言。使用VBA代码可以自动化重复最后一行的操作,适用于需要频繁重复该操作的情况。
2、代码示例
下面是一个简单的VBA代码示例,用于重复最后一行:
Sub RepeatLastRow()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1") ' 请根据需要更改工作表名称
Dim lastRow As Long
lastRow = ws.Cells(ws.Rows.Count, 1).End(xlUp).Row
ws.Rows(lastRow).Copy Destination:=ws.Rows(lastRow + 1)
End Sub
3、代码解释
- Set ws = ThisWorkbook.Sheets("Sheet1"):指定要操作的工作表。
- lastRow = ws.Cells(ws.Rows.Count, 1).End(xlUp).Row:找到最后一行的行号。
- ws.Rows(lastRow).Copy Destination:=ws.Rows(lastRow + 1):将最后一行复制到下一行。
4、运行代码
- 打开Excel文件,按下Alt+F11进入VBA编辑器。
- 在“插入”菜单中选择“模块”。
- 将上述代码粘贴到模块中。
- 按下F5运行代码。
三、利用公式
1、简介
利用Excel中的公式可以动态重复最后一行的数据,适用于需要实时更新的数据表格。
2、公式示例
可以使用以下公式在目标位置重复最后一行的数据:
=INDEX(A:A, COUNTA(A:A))
3、公式解释
- INDEX(A:A, COUNTA(A:A)):该公式返回列A中最后一个非空单元格的值。
4、应用方法
- 在目标位置输入上述公式。
- 向下拖动填充柄,以复制公式到其他单元格。
四、高级技巧
1、动态表格
使用Excel的动态表格功能可以自动扩展数据区域,适用于需要频繁更新的数据表格。
2、数据验证
通过设置数据验证规则,可以确保在重复最后一行时数据的一致性和有效性。
3、条件格式
条件格式可以帮助突出显示重复的数据,便于审核和检查。
五、项目管理中的应用
在项目管理中,重复最后一行数据库操作经常用于记录和追踪项目进度、任务分配和资源管理。推荐使用以下两个系统来提高管理效率:
- 研发项目管理系统PingCode:专为研发项目设计,提供全面的项目管理功能。
- 通用项目协作软件Worktile:适用于各种类型的项目协作,提供灵活的任务管理和团队协作功能。
六、总结
通过本文的介绍,您已经了解了在Excel中重复最后一行数据库的多种方法,包括直接复制粘贴、使用VBA代码、利用公式以及一些高级技巧。每种方法都有其独特的优势和适用场景,您可以根据具体需求选择合适的方法。无论是简单的手动操作还是复杂的自动化任务,都可以通过合理使用这些技巧来提高工作效率。
相关问答FAQs:
1. 如何在Excel中重复最后一行的数据库内容?
- 首先,确保你的Excel表格已经包含了数据库内容,并且最后一行是你想要重复的行。
- 接下来,选中最后一行的数据,包括所有的单元格。
- 然后,按下Ctrl+C复制这些数据。
- 在Excel表格中找到你想要重复的位置,将光标移动到下一个空白行的开始处。
- 使用Ctrl+V粘贴刚刚复制的数据,这样就重复了最后一行的数据库内容。
2. 我如何用Excel复制最后一行的数据库信息?
- 首先,确保你的Excel表格已经包含了数据库信息,并且最后一行是你想要复制的行。
- 接下来,选中最后一行的数据,包括所有的单元格。
- 然后,按下Ctrl+C复制这些数据。
- 在Excel表格中找到你想要复制的位置,将光标移动到下一个空白行的开始处。
- 使用Ctrl+V粘贴刚刚复制的数据,这样就复制了最后一行的数据库信息。
3. 如何在Excel中复制最后一行的数据库记录?
- 首先,确保你的Excel表格已经包含了数据库记录,并且最后一行是你想要复制的记录。
- 接下来,选中最后一行的数据,包括所有的单元格。
- 然后,按下Ctrl+C复制这些数据。
- 在Excel表格中找到你想要复制的位置,将光标移动到下一个空白行的开始处。
- 使用Ctrl+V粘贴刚刚复制的数据,这样就复制了最后一行的数据库记录。
原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1987905